Why choose the B&B Hotel near Disneyland Paris?

  • As an official Disneyland Paris partner hotel, you can enjoy the benefits of stays sold by Disneyland Paris, including a shuttle bus, extra magic hours, customer service and free parking.
  • You will struggle to find a more affordable and convenient accommodation option near the parks.
  • Despite being positioned as ‘entry-level accommodation’, the hotel has received very positive reviews from guests. In fact, the feedback has been quite flattering compared to other, more expensive hotels at Disneyland Paris.
  • Its prime location is one of this 2-star hotel’s biggest assets! Located in the Val de France area, alongside the Dream Castle Hotel and the Explorers Hotel, it is only a 10-minute shuttle ride from the park entrance.

How much does a stay at the B&B Hotel Disney cost?

No matter what type of stay you choose, this hotel remains one of the cheapest in Marne-la-Vallée! You can book one or more nights without tickets or an all-inclusive stay on the official Disneyland Paris website.

Here are some prices for a one night stay in a B&B hotel, plus tickets and breakfast:

Dates of visit Price for 2 adults Price for 2 adults + 1 child
A weekend stay in a standard room from 18 to 19 October 2025. 613€ 818€
Christmas season stay in standard room from 13 to 14 December 613€ 818€
A weekly stay from Wednesday 14 to Thursday 15 January 2026 390€ 533€

On average, the B&B at Disneyland Paris is 10% cheaper than the Explorer Hotel for the same level of comfort (but without water activities). It is also slightly cheaper than the Elysée Val d’Europe Hotel, which is further away from the parks as it is located in Val d’Europe.

However, for the selected dates, we found that several Disney hotels were cheaper, including the Disney Hotel Cheyenne and the Disney Santa Fe. These are all located near Disney Village and offer a magical Disney theme. Please note, however, that, unlike the B&B, which includes breakfast, you will need to budget an additional €24 per adult and €17 per child for a similar package. For a family staying for several days, the bill can quickly become expensive!

Where is the B&B Hotel Disneyland Paris situated?

In terms of location, it couldn’t be closer (except for the Disney hotels, of course!). As you can see, it is only a few minutes away from Disneyland Park, Walt Disney Studios Park and Disney Village.

The pleasant surroundings of this establishment are also worth mentioning. The Avenue de la Fosse des Pressoirs is a green and sparsely populated area, and the hotel overlooks the Mallard Pond, which is located just opposite the Dream Castle Hotel.

The Val de France free shuttle bus

Like all the other hotels in the area, the B&B is served by a complimentary shuttle bus that will take you to Disneyland Paris and back to your hotel at the end of the day. This free service is reserved for guests staying at Val de France hotels (Explorers Hotel, Dream Castle, Grand Magic Hotel) and runs from 8 a.m. to 1 a.m. every day, all year round. Accessible to families with pushchairs and people with reduced mobility, the shuttle offers a quick and easy way to reach the parks.

However, it often struggles to keep up with demand during busy times.

Recommended by Disneyland Paris since 2016!

For the ninth year in a row, the Bed and Breakfast in Magny le Hongre will be part of the exclusive group of ‘Disneyland Paris partner hotels‘ in 2025. This establishment has enjoyed a special relationship with Disneyland Paris and the Euro Disney group ever since it opened in 2016.

Let’s start with an anecdote that few Disney enthusiasts and guests know about. The hotel’s unique architecture is the result of a collaboration between the French B&B group and the urban planning and architecture teams at Real Estate Development by Euro Disney.

Disney pays close attention to everything, especially hotels so close to its parks! So it’s no surprise that the Disney B&B hotel is so popular!

The range of rooms available at the B&B Disney Hotel

This B&B Hotels establishment, located just outside Disneyland Paris, is perfect for families with children. Before we present the advantages of these family rooms, here are all the room types available at B&B Disneyland Paris.

  • Double room for two people (13 m²): couples can enjoy affordable accommodation for a romantic getaway with Mickey.
  • A triple room for three adults (16 m²): travelling with friends or a teenager? This room has a double bed and a single bed and can sleep up to three people.
  • Family room for four people (16 m²): available with either bunk beds or single beds, this room ensures that each child has their own bed, although we know that children love fighting over twin beds!
  • Family room for five people (16 m²): Although B&B does not offer connecting rooms, large families with three children can stay near Disneyland Paris at an affordable price. However, there are no bunk beds, only three single beds.

Where can you eat near the B&B hotel?

There are two important meals to help you get through a day at the theme parks: breakfast and dinner. Both can be enjoyed at the B&B Disneyland Paris, a hotel restaurant with a snack bar.

Breakfast is included!

A breakfast is included in any stay at the B&B, whether you book a room only or a package that includes a hotel and tickets. I haven’t tried it myself yet. But reviews of the buffet seem pretty good overall. It offers a fairly varied selection, including traditional pastries, an English breakfast buffet, fruit and different types of bread. In short, it’s everything you need to fuel up before a busy day.

Les Halles is the B&B Hotel’s snack bar.

Don’t feel like leaving the hotel for dinner? From 6 p.m. onwards, you can enjoy a meal with family or friends at the Les Halles snack bar, with a choice of pasta, pizza and salads.

The quality of the establishment does not seem to be reflected in the reviews of the snack bar. It is more of a stopgap solution than a mecca for Marnavalian gastronomy.

Nearby restaurants:

As there are few places to eat in Val de France and the area surrounding the B&B, the best option is to head to Disney Village and the Disney hotels.

This area is accessible via the free shuttle bus, which also runs on the way back. We therefore recommend either dining at Disney Village after visiting the parks or utilizing the shuttle bus or an Uber to dine at one of the many restaurants in the proximate Disney hotels, such as the Downtown Restaurant (Hotel Marvel), the Cantina (Hotel Santa Fe) or the Chuck Wagon Cafe (Hotel Cheyenne).

What’s not to like about the Disney B&B?

Despite its two-star rating, neither the room furnishings nor the bedding are to blame. After analysing almost a hundred reviews posted on Google, here’s what we found:

  • The bathroom (58% negative reviews): this room attracts a lot of criticism, much of which is focused on the small size of the bathrooms and the need to renovate the paintwork and furniture.
  • The hotel restaurant’s cuisine (62% of reviews are negative): the quality of the food and the prices charged by the Les Halles snack bar are another major sticking point. Similarly, the lack of space and variety at the breakfast buffet is often mentioned in negative reviews.
  • The air conditioning, which received 68% of negative reviews, is a particular problem as almost all reviews mention the noise it generates, which seems impossible to turn off.

What do the reviews say about this two-star hotel near Disneyland Paris?

For a simple two-star hotel, the reviews are surprisingly positive! The most frequently cited strengths are the cleanliness of the rooms, the setting and atmosphere, the location and the price.

Here is a summary of reviews from guests who have stayed at this hotel:

  • Google rating: 4.2/5 (>19,000 reviews)
  • Tripadvisor rating: 3.9/5 (based on over 2,830 reviews).
  • Booking.com rating: 3.9/5 (19,751 reviews*)
  • Average rating: 3.9/5

Ratings recorded in May 2025.

My review of the B&B close to Disneyland Paris

Location : 5 / 5

While there are certainly hotels closer to Disneyland Paris and Walt Disney Studios, few of them offer accommodation of such high quality at such competitive rates as this B&B. Thanks to its free shuttle service, which runs all day until late in the evening, you can quickly return to the magic of the parks and Disney Village. The location is undoubtedly this establishment’s greatest asset. However, be aware that the shuttle is often full! You could consider taking an Uber, which would cost no more than €15 for several people.


Accomodation : 3 / 5 

Overall, residents seem satisfied with the cleanliness and space of the rooms. While you shouldn’t expect the finishes and comfort of a 4-star hotel at this price, the overall experience is more than satisfactory. However, the B&B rooms suffer from one major problem: poor insulation. Many reviews mention being disturbed by the comings and goings in the corridors at night.


Food : 1 / 5

Here is another bad point about the B and B Hotel Disney. The hotel’s only dining option, the Les Halles snack bar, doesn’t appear to be a hit with all its guests. Its high prices and ready-made meals are widely criticised. Our recommendation is to go to one of the Disney restaurants in the nearby hotels if you can.


Activities : 1 / 5 

Guests of B&B Hotels are not known to expect many additional activities. While there is an arcade and a Disney store within the hotel, these are no match for competitors such as Explorers or Dream Castle. However, it’s difficult to criticise B&B for this, as I doubt you or your children will have the energy for anything else after a day at Disneyland Paris.
